| #[cfg(feature = "std")] |
| #[test] |
| fn high_level_sync() -> Result<(), crate::errors::Error> { |
| use crate::context::TlsContextBuilder; |
| use crate::credentials::{Certificate, TlsCredentialBuilder}; |
| use crate::tests::{CA, RSA_SERVER_CERT, RSA_SERVER_KEY}; |
| use bssl_x509::certificates::X509Certificate; |
| use bssl_x509::keys::PrivateKey; |
| use bssl_x509::store::X509StoreBuilder; |
| use std::io::{Read, Write}; |
| |
| let ca = Certificate::parse_one_from_pem(CA, None)?; |
| let server_cert = Certificate::parse_one_from_pem(RSA_SERVER_CERT, None)?; |
| let server_key = PrivateKey::from_pem(RSA_SERVER_KEY, || unreachable!())?; |
| |
| let mut server_ctx_builder = TlsContextBuilder::new_tls(); |
| let server_cred = { |
| let mut builder = TlsCredentialBuilder::new(); |
| builder |
| .with_certificate_chain(&[server_cert, ca])? |
| .with_private_key(server_key)?; |
| builder.build() |
| }; |
| server_ctx_builder.with_credential(server_cred.unwrap())?; |
| let mut builder = TlsContextBuilder::new_tls(); |
| let ca = X509Certificate::parse_one_from_pem(CA)?; |
| let store = { |
| let mut store = X509StoreBuilder::new(); |
| store.set_trust(Trust::SslServer)?.add_cert(ca)?; |
| store.build() |
| }; |
| builder.with_certificate_store(&store); |
| let connector = builder.build_connector(); |
| let acceptor = server_ctx_builder.build_acceptor(); |
| |
| let listener = std::net::TcpListener::bind("127.0.0.1:0").unwrap(); |
| let addr = listener.local_addr().unwrap(); |
| |
| let server_thread = std::thread::spawn(move || { |
| let (stream, _) = listener.accept().unwrap(); |
| let mut tls_stream = acceptor.accept(stream).unwrap(); |
| |
| let mut buf = [0; 5]; |
| tls_stream.read_exact(&mut buf).unwrap(); |
| assert_eq!(&buf, b"hello"); |
| |
| tls_stream.write_all(b"world").unwrap(); |
| tls_stream.flush().unwrap(); |
| }); |
| |
| let stream = std::net::TcpStream::connect(addr).unwrap(); |
| let mut tls_stream = connector.connect("www.google.com", stream).unwrap(); |
| |
| tls_stream.write_all(b"hello").unwrap(); |
| tls_stream.flush().unwrap(); |
| |
| let mut buf = [0; 5]; |
| tls_stream.read_exact(&mut buf).unwrap(); |
| assert_eq!(&buf, b"world"); |
| |
| server_thread.join().unwrap(); |
| |
| Ok(()) |
| } |
